  1. Material Quality:
    Material quality in lightweight hardside 29-spinner luggage pertains to the composition of the suitcase. Common materials include polycarbonate and ABS (Acrylonitrile Butadiene Styrene). Polycarbonate is known for its strength and flexibility, making it resistant to cracks and dents. ABS is lighter but slightly less durable. According to a study by the Travel Goods Association (TGA) in 2022, polycarbonate luggage can withstand more impact compared to ABS.

  2. Weight:
    Weight refers to the overall heaviness of the luggage. Lightweight luggage typically weighs between 6 to 9 pounds when empty. A lighter suitcase allows for more packing without exceeding airline weight limits. Airlines often impose extra fees for overweight luggage, so a lightweight design can save money for travelers.

  3. Size and Dimensions:
    Size and dimensions indicate how much space you have for packing. A 29-inch spinner is generally suited for longer trips. Most suitcases should measure about 29 inches tall, 18 inches wide, and 12-15 inches deep. Checking airline regulations for checked luggage sizing is crucial, as non-compliance can lead to extra fees or denied boarding.

  4. Wheel System:
    The wheel system refers to the type and quality of wheels on the suitcase. Four spinner wheels offer 360-degree maneuverability and are easier to navigate in crowded spaces. In contrast, two wheels provide stability and are advantageous when pulling heavy loads. According to a survey by Consumer Reports, users prefer spinners for overall ease of use.

  5. Handle Design:
    Handle design includes the extendable handle and grip type. An ergonomically designed handle should be comfortable during long hauls and should have multiple heights for convenience. A study by the International Journal of Travel Management indicated that poorly designed handles lead to user fatigue and dissatisfaction.

  6. Locking Mechanism:
    The locking mechanism offers security for your belongings. Most suitcases feature either a TSA lock or a built-in combination lock. TSA-approved locks allow luggage inspectors to open bags without damaging locks. According to TSA guidelines, using approved locks can help prevent theft during air travel.

  7. Interior Organization:
    Interior organization refers to compartments and pockets inside the suitcase. Features such as mesh dividers, zipped pockets, and compression straps can help pack efficiently. According to a study by the Journal of Travel Research, well-organized luggage can reduce the time spent searching for items while traveling.

  8. Expandability:
    Expandability means the suitcase can increase in size as needed. This feature is particularly useful for travelers who may bring back souvenirs or extra items. Expandable suitcases typically offer an extra couple of inches in depth and can accommodate a flexible packing strategy.

  9. Color and Design:
    Color and design encompass the aesthetics of the luggage. Consumers often prefer bright colors for easy identification on baggage claim carousels. Additionally, patterns can convey personal style. Trend reports from Vogue indicate that luggage design trends are increasingly focusing on unique and personalized aesthetics.

How Much Should You Expect to Pay for Lightweight Hardside 29 Spinner Luggage?

You should expect to pay between $100 and $300 for lightweight hardside 29-inch spinner luggage. This price range reflects various factors such as brand, materials, and features.

Luggage from budget brands typically costs between $100 and $150. Mid-range options generally fall between $150 and $200. Premium brands may charge $200 to $300 for their products, often featuring advanced materials, higher durability, and extended warranties.

For example, a well-known budget option like the AmazonBasics 29-Inch Spinner may retail for around $120. In contrast, a high-end brand like Samsonite or Travelpro may offer a durable suitcase ranging from $250 to $300.

Several factors can influence the pricing of lightweight hardside 29-inch spinners. Materials such as polycarbonate or polypropylene enhance durability but may raise the cost. Additionally, features like TSA-approved locks, expandable compartments, and multi-directional wheels can also contribute to price variations. Seasonal sales and promotions may result in discounted prices, offering potential savings.

It is important to note that prices may fluctuate based on location, retailer, and availability. Comparing different brands and checking customer reviews can help determine the best value for your needs.

How Can You Maintain Your Lightweight Hardside 29 Spinner Luggage for Longevity?

To maintain your lightweight hardside 29 spinner luggage for longevity, you should follow proper cleaning, careful handling, and secure storage practices.

Proper cleaning: Regularly clean your luggage to keep it in good condition. Use a soft cloth and mild soap to wipe the exterior. Pay attention to the zippers, wheels, and handles, as debris can accumulate in these areas.

Careful handling: Handle your luggage with care. Avoid dropping or dragging it on rough surfaces. When placing it in overhead compartments or on conveyor belts, ensure it is not subjected to excessive force or pressure. This helps prevent cracks or dents.

Secure storage: Store your luggage in a cool, dry place when not in use. High humidity and extreme temperatures can affect the material. Use a dust cover to keep it protected from dust and scratches.

Wheel maintenance: Inspect the spinner wheels regularly. Remove any dirt or debris stuck in the wheels to maintain smooth movement. If the wheels become damaged, replace them promptly to avoid further issues.

Zipper care: Lubricate the zippers occasionally with a silicone spray. This helps keep them functioning smoothly and prevents snagging or breaking. Inspect zippers for any signs of wear and act swiftly if issues arise.

Additionally, be mindful of weight limits when packing. Overpacking can stress the luggage structure. Stick to airline guidelines to ensure your luggage lasts longer.
